Overview: As part of a major reorganization, British Petroleum (BP) America decided to outsource support and maintenance of its Information Technology (IT) functions and systems. Included in the decision was an extensive Electronic Commerce and Data Interchange (EC/EDI) application with many trading partners and transaction sets. BP America asked CTG to help it deliver cost-effective EC/EDI services and provide a single center of expertise for EDI and other electronic commerce methods for its North American business operations. Under a managed services agreement, CTG provides BP America in North America with a centralized EC/EDI department.
